BULLDOGS OPEN INDOOR SEASON AT NORTHEASTERN WINTER CARNIVAL

BOSTON - The Bryant men's and women's indoor track teams opened their respective seasons this past weekend at the Northeastern University Husky Winter Carnival at Reggie Lewis Center. Senior Hafiz Greigre (Attleboro, MA) took home Bryant's lone first place finish on the afternoon, winning the men's 400 meter dash in a school record time of 48.23 seconds, passing his old record of 49.10 set a year ago. Sophomore Alex Engel (Spencer, MA) was fifth in 50.39.
Freshman Thomas O'Connor (Westwood, MA) had a fine afternoon, placing 14th in the prelims of the 55 meter dash in 6.74 seconds and later placing fifth in the men's 200 meters in 22.97 seconds.
Sophomore Nathaniel Green (York, ME) took 17th in the men's 5,000 meters in 15:55.14 while teammate Tom Casey (Cornwall, NY) was 18th in 15:57.14. The Bulldog 4x400 meter relay squad took second in a time of 3:20.94, just behind first place Albany's time of 3:19.21.
On the women's side, Stephanie Montagano (Wakefield, MA) placed sixth in the 400 meters in 60:04 while senior Nicole Radzik (Sutton, MA), coming off an exception fall cross country season, placed fourth in the 5,000 meters in 17:38.90.
Freshman Stephanie Kirk (Pompton Lakes, NJ) set
a new school mark in the 55 meter hurdles, finishing 15th in 9.22
seconds, just passing the school's 25 year old mark of 9.23 held by
Debbie Enos (1983). In the field events, Samantha
Genatossio (Norwell, MA) placed 13th in the women's triple
jump (33 feet, 6.75 inches) while senior Amber Torrey
(Plainfield, NH) was 14th in the women's shot put and 12th
in the women's weight throw. The teams will return to action this
Saturday at the Harvard Invitational in Boston.
